U+17EE7 "饤户" Tangut Ideograph-# is part of the Tangut script block, which encodes the historical writing system of the Tangut Empire that flourished in northwestern China from the 11th to 13th centuries. This specific ideograph represents one of the thousands of logographic characters used by the Tangut language, which was deciphered primarily through the discovery of the Tangut-Chinese bilingual dictionary known as the Pearl in the Palm. Like other Tangut characters, U+17EE7 is composed of complex strokes and radicals that convey both semantic and phonetic components, though its precise meaning and pronunciation remain a subject of ongoing scholarly research due to the incomplete nature of the language's reconstruction. The inclusion of this character in the Unicode standard allows for its digital representation, aiding the preservation and study of this ancient script in modern computing environments.
